John Bartlett (1820–1905).  Familiar Quotations, 10th ed.  1919.
 
 
NUMBER:2532
AUTHOR:John Milton (1608–1674)
QUOTATION:I fled, and cry’d out, DEATH!
Hell trembled at the hideous name, and sigh’d
From all her caves, and back resounded, DEATH!
ATTRIBUTION:Paradise Lost. Book ii. Line 787.
